The BIALL Legal Journals Award 2017 has been awarded to Family Law, pictured above.
Jonathan Cailes and Samantha Bangham received the award from the BIALL President, Sandra Smythe’ at the BIALL Annual Dinner which took place at the Principal Hotel, Manchester, on the 9th June 2017.
Authoritative and therefore invaluable to practitioners, the journal was commended by the judging panel for its currency, indexing, and clear and concise layout.
· The BIALL Supplier of the Year Award 2017 has been awarded to CRO Info.
CRO Info received the award from the BIALL President, Sandra Smythe at the BIALL Annual Dinner which took place at the Principal Hotel, Manchester, on the 9th June 2017.
Customers of the award winner describe them as extremely professional, knowledgeable and customer-focussed. They are considered very responsive to customer feedback and suggestions, which is especially positive for a relatively new service, and they are also described as extremely pleasant to deal with.
· The BIALL Life Membership Award 2017 has been awarded to David Wills.
David received the award from the BIALL President, Sandra Smythe at the BIALL Annual Dinner which took place at the Principal Hotel, Manchester, on the 9th June 2017.
In addition, to fulfilling a number of the most time demanding roles in BIALL, David shows great enthusiasm for our profession and is a great advocate for law librarianship but never loses his sense of humour. He is a well-liked member of our community who offers encouragement and support for members to become involved with BIALL activities..
· The BIALL Wildy Law Librarian of the Year Award 2017 has been awarded to Margaret Clay.
Margaret received the award from the BIALL President, Sandra Smythe at the BIALL Annual Dinner which took place at the Principal Hotel, Manchester, on the 9th June 2017.
The awarding committee believe that Margaret has made a significant contribution to the legal information profession and that after 26 years of dedicated commitment at Inner Temple Library and to BIALL that she is fully deserving of the Wildy BIALL Law Librarian of the Year Award 2017.
